.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

Calling webservice from the server

Posted By:      Posted Date: August 21, 2010    Points: 0   Category :ASP.Net

I have a sample web service and aspx file. I deployed them to an existing website that contains classic asp files.

web-service: --- using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.Web.Services; [WebService(Namespace = "http://localhost/MyWebServices/")] public class MembershipRegisWebService : System.Web.Services.WebService { public MembershipRegisWebService () { //Uncomment the following line if using designed components //InitializeComponent(); } [WebMethod] public string HelloWorld() { return "Hello World."; } }

aspx.cs file: --- using System; using System.Collections.Generic; using System.Web; using System.Web.UI; using System.Web.UI.WebControls; using System.Web.Services; public partial class CallWebService : System.Web.UI.Page { protected void Page_Load(object sender, EventArgs e) { MembershipRegisWebService mrWs = new MembershipRegisWebService(); Response.Write("Calling web service:" + mrWs.HelloWorld()); } }

It runs locally, but it shows an error when running it from the server:

Server Error in '/' Application. Compilation Error Description: An error occurred during the compilation of a resource required to service this request. Please review the follow

View Complete Post

More Related Resource Links

Calling a webservice in MVC using jquery works on dev box not prod box


I have a webservice that is part of the MVC project.  I am using VS 2010 MVC 2.0 on Windows 7.  When I run the web application locally the webservice call works flawlessly, however on the prod box using  2008 upgraded with asp.net 4.0 it fails.

I get an error "The controller for path '/services/traxservices.aspx/upDateCustomer' was not found or does not implement IController. "

Is there some type of issue with the settings in the global.ascx or in IIS that I am missing?


Any help would be appreciated.

How to avoid network problems while calling a webservice in a SQL CLR trigger?

Hi All, My Goal: DB synchronization between SQL server 2005 and Mysql database via web services. I have created a SQLCLR trigger, in which i'm calling a web service to sync/update remote (MYSQL) DB over a specific constraints. After getting the acknowledgment from web service i'm updating the sync flag to success (In SQL SERVER2005). If any network delay happens i am unable to know whether sync has done successfully or not. How to avoid network dependency here? Is there any reliable queuing mechanism available in sql server 2005 to eliminate dependency over network? I am looking any suitable service/approach in sql server 2005 that can take care of calling web services as asynchronously and update the status of sync flag irrespective of network. Thanks in advance if anyone provide the good approach as step by step in detail.

calling a web service on a remote server from an ASPX page

hi, I want to call a web service on a remote server. I've done "add web reference" in my project, and VS2005 has created the .discomap and .WSDL in the App_Web_Reference folder. When I try add the namespace representing the web server (the name I created when I added the web reference) by "using XXXXX;" the code does not compile because XXXXX is not defined. Have I missed any steps? thanks, -me

calling a web service on a remote server from a ASPX page (web site project VS2005)

HI,I am maintaining a web site project in VS2005 and have to call a new web service on a remote server. I've done add web reference, and created the .wsdl and .discomap files in the app_webReference folder.  When I try to create a object representing the web service in the code ( wsnamespace.serviceName ws = new wsnamespce.serviceName(); ) the code wouldn't compile.The web site project is already calling other web services. When I right click on the type representing the web service and "go to definition" it takes me to a proxy class (derived from of course SoapHttpClientProtocol) in the metadata. I think this is what's missing for  the new web service i'm trying to call. Have I missed any steps?Thanks in advance.-me

JAVA calling SQL Server Procedure

Reply Contact I have a JAVA developer asking me this question.  I am not sure how to answer him.  I am not sure I understand his question.  He is using JAVA to call my procedure. "Is there some conclusive signal returned by the the SP result that would letus know whether it succeeded or failed? I'm currently looking for the word "exception" in the error message, but that hardly seems conclusive to me." lcerni

WCF MTOM Client calling Java Webservice - Issues with File attachment Content ID encoded in SOAP mes

Hello,I'm having difficulty calling a MTOM enabled Java based web service that accepts an file as input..NET appeats to be generating a SOAP message where the reference to the binary part of the message is an encoded url.For Example:  <inc:Include href="cid:http%3A%2F%2Ftempuri.org%2F1%2F634000265217257868" xmlns:inc="http://www.w3.org/2004/08/xop/include"/>In fact, the Content ID defined in the SOAP message, looks nothing like the actual Content ID of the actual message part.Content-ID: <http://tempuri.org/1/634000265217257868=2787915398744@soapui.org>The service is invoked and executed on the java webserver...but the data element appears to be null.I do not believe the java web server understands the reference in the SOAP message because it is encoded....Or...perhaps it's because the Content-ID attribute has extract stuff on it.I'm working with a custom MTOM encoder in WCF....is there a way to generate your own Content ID or tell .NET not to encode the url?My frustration with .NET has reached an all new level with this project...Any help would be greatly appreciated.Here the SOAP message that is being generated:<soapenv:Envelope xmlns:soapenv="http://www.w3.org/2003/05/soap-envelope" xmlns:ns="http://docs.oasis-open.org/ns/cmis/messaging/200901" xmlns:ns1="http://docs.oasis-open.org/ns/cmis/core/200901&q

Calling a Server side function from Javascript without using PageMethods

Good Day alli have used PageMethods to access the server side functions in javascript , but now my problem is that with pagemethods your controls will not go throught the full page lifecyle and these leads me to have "Object not set for an instance of an object" error. Now can someone come with a differnt approach without using pagemethods. What i want is to call a server side function , i dont want to pass any parameters to itthanks

Webservice, server was unable to process request error


System.Web.Services.Protocols.SoapException: Server was unable to process request. ---> System.Xml.XmlException: Data at the root level is invalid. Line 1, position 1.
   at System.Xml.XmlTextReaderImpl.Throw(Exception e)
   at System.Xml.XmlTextReaderImpl.Throw(String res, String arg)
   at System.Xml.XmlTextReaderImpl.ParseRootLevelWhitespace()
   at System.Xml.XmlTextReaderImpl.ParseDocumentContent()
   at System.Xml.XmlTextReaderImpl.Read()
   at System.Xml.XsdValidatingReader.Read()
   at System.Xml.XmlLoader.Load(XmlDocument doc, XmlReader reader, Boolean preserveWhitespace)
   at System.Xml.XmlDocument.Load(XmlReader reader)
   at BusinessObjects.OrderHelper.PlaceOrder(String StrorderXml) in C:\Documents and Settings\mchinta\My Documents\Visual Studio 2008\Projects\CcbApp\BusinessObjects\OrderHelper.cs:line 63
   at IServiceReference.IOrder.PlaceOrder(String orderXml) in C:\Documents and Settings\mchinta\My Documents\Visual Studio 2008\Projects\CcbApp\IServiceReference\IOrder.asmx.cs:line 24
   --- End of inner exception stack trace ---

Here is my XML

<?xml version='1.0' encoding='utf-8' ?><Order>Data</Order>

My S

Calling WCF Service from SQL Server 2008



        I'm facing a problem in accessing a WCF Service from a stored procedure in SQL Server 2008. The error obtained is as follows. An pointers to solve this issue wud be very helpful.

Msg 6522, Level 16, State 1, Procedure USP_CLR_ADD, Line 0
A .NET Framework error occurred during execution of user-defined routine or aggregate "USP_CLR_ADD":
System.TypeInitializationException: The type initializer for 'System.ServiceModel.ClientBase`1' threw an exception. ---> System.Security.HostProtectionException: Attempted to perform an operation that was forbidden by the CLR host.

The protected resources (only available with full trust) were: All
The demanded resources were: Synchronization, ExternalThreading

   at System.ServiceModel.DiagnosticUtility.GetUtility()
   at System.ServiceModel.DiagnosticUtility.get_Utility()
   at System.ServiceModel.ClientBase`1..cctor()
   at System.ServiceModel.ClientBase`1.InitializeChannelFactoryRef()
   at System.ServiceModel.ClientBase`1..ctor()
   at TestServiceClient..ctor()
   at Channel.ServiceChannel.GetSum()


Webservice timeout while calling windows service



We have a .net product built in .Net 2.0.
It consist of three blocks.
First is a asp.net web application which calls webservice which in turn call a windows service to get results from database.
Our problem is that windows service is taking time to get results from database because of which timeout is occuring.

Now we have already set timeout property in web application while calling web service through proxy. However, we could not find how to set timeout property for webservice(This will stop webervice from timeout before windows service send back the result).

If somebody have done it, please help


asp.net log in + webservice + sql server


Hi guys

I am trying to write a website. Before a user can use this website it has to provide it's username and password. These informations (username password) are saved on a sql server. I am also thinking to use web service   to control if the  informations  (username  password) that the user entered are correct. I also would like to use cookie (once a user get authenticated). As a web server am using IIS 7.5 .

My questions are:

1 - Once a user click log-in button it calls the web service which controls if these informations are stored on slq server. Lets suppose for a moment that they are correct. What command line do i have to use to tell the web server that the user now is authenticated.

2 - Do i have to tell the web server that it has to provide a cookie to the client or it does it by default.

3 - Let's suppose a user after get authenticated can do some operations on database. How can i tell the web service that this user is  already authenticated?? 

Sorry for bothering your guys but i really don't know where else to go...

WCF calling webservice - assigning return value taking a long time

0 down vote favorite

I have a wcf service (WCF_A ) which calls another wcf service (WCF_B) (currently I am hosting the WCF_B on my local machine with my credentials – as windows service), WCF_B internally makes a call to a webservice (WS01) that is hosted on the IIS. I have created a test client and call the WCF_A -> WCF_B -> WS01. Just before making the call to (WS01) I start a timer and I stop the timer when the webservice call comes back and the result is assigned to a variable, the flow is as below WCF_B

1)  Debug.WriteLine(“Call to webservice”) 
2)  Starttimer 
3)  Var result = WS01.Function(xxxx) 
4)  Stop

Getting Error SECU1075: While calling webservice from C# DLL,WinForms



I have designed a console application as a web service client which is able to talk with webservice; however instead of console application if I design a WinForm or DLL of the same code I am getting following error message.

SECU1075: An error was discovered processing the <wsse:Security> header | System.Web.Services |    at System.Web.Services.Protocols.SoapHttpClientProtocol.ReadResponse(SoapClientMessage message, WebResponse response, Stream responseStream, Boolean asyncCall)
at System.Web.Services.Protocols.SoapHttpClientProtocol.Invoke(String methodName, Object[] parameters)...

The only difference I figured out is, in case of DLL or WinForm it is creating an extra DLL with name <ProjectName>.XmlSerializers.dll which is not the case with Console application.

Anybody know what should I need to do to call the webservice from DLL instead of console application? Help appreciated

jQuery / javascript calling a webservice


I've tried a bunch of different examples and still can't get this to work.

I have a jQuery GalleryView control I'm using and I simply want to log impressions.  I set up a webservice that works, but I can't figure out how to get it to work in javascript.  I have verified that the webservice is working as expected.

Imports System.Web
Imports System.Web.Services
Imports System.Web.Services.Protocols
' To allow this Web Service to be called from script, using ASP.NET AJAX, uncomment the following line.
' <System.Web.Script.Services.ScriptServ

Calling Javascript confirm from server-side



This normally should not be difficult but I am just starting javascript.

The case is very simple.Before I delete  the record from the gridview ,I want to call the confim windows in order to give the user the opportunity of ok oe cancel.

in the client side I do not have any reference to javascript.

The first touch with it ,it happents in the following code:

 public void grdomas_RowDataBound(Object sender, GridViewRowEventArgs e)
            if (e.Row.RowType == DataControlRowType.DataRow)
                ImageButton  l = (ImageButton)e.Row.FindControl("imgdelete");

                l.Attributes.Add("onclick","javascript:return " + "confirm('Are you sure you want to delete this record? ')");

The image button is defined in the aspx as:
<asp:ImageButton ID="imgdelete"   runat="server" ImageUrl="~/Images/DeleteNew.bmp"  Width="20px" Height="20px" ToolTip="Delete" CommandName="Delete" CommandArgument='<%# Container.DataItemIndex + 1 %>'/>

asp.net webservice ERROR on production server.


Hi All,

 I'm using a web service in my asp.net 3.5 application.The web-service is hosted in my live server and it is working fine. My web application is also hosted in the same server.But when i try to access the webservice from my asp.net web application hosted online,I'm getting the following error.

[SocketException (0x274c): A connection attempt failed because the connected party did not properly respond after a period of time, or established connection failed because connected host has failed to respond xx.xx.xx.xx:80]
   System.Net.Sockets.Socket.DoConnect(EndPoint endPointSnapshot, SocketAddress socketAddress) +239
   System.Net.Sockets.Socket.InternalConnect(EndPoint remoteEP) +35
   System.Net.ServicePoint.ConnectSocketInternal(Boolean connectFailure, Socket s4, Socket s6, Socket& socket, IPAddress& address, ConnectSocketState state, IAsyncResult asyncResult, Int32 timeout, Exception& exception) +224

I'm able to call the online webservice from my web application hosted locally on my system and it is working fine.

Thanks in advance


Calling a javascript function from server side, using AJAX timer



I am developing a ASP.NET ajax application.
I am using a timer:

<asp:Timer ID="Timer1" runat="server" OnTick="Timer_Tick" Interval="5000" />      

The only thing I want to do is to call a javascript function on every tick of the timer:

 protected void Timer_Tick(object sender, EventArgs e)
            ClientScript.RegisterClientScriptBlock(this.GetType(), "blink", "<script>blinkit('2');</script>");

This doesn't work.
The javascript function is being called only if I put the 'RegisterClientScriptBlock' in the Page_Load.

How can I call the javascript every couple of seconds?

Thank you

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end